dog wont stop shaking.. Hey guys, first post here, basically my yorkshire puppy who is about 10months old hasnt been himself today, he was fine in the morning but around the afternoon he started crying for no reason and just seem really dazed. I managed to calm him down but sometimes he is shaking and i thought it was because he was cold but that doesnt seem to be the problem He hasn't eaten since 5 and has only drunk a little bit, it just seems like he wants to curl up and sleep, ive tried feeding him all sorts of stuff and given him some milk but he hasnt touched any of it, the only time he seems to come alive is when our other dog walks past and he wags his tail and gets a little excited..does any one have any ideas of what i can do? |
Have you called your vet? I would do that ASAP if you haven't! It could be a lot of things, but I wouldn't delay in calling and taking him in. Please let us know how he is!! |
hey we wont be able to until tomorrow since its not a 24hour vet and its pretty late here so they wont be open, he seems to be doing a little better now, he had some water and i was playing around with him a little earlier before he went back to bed. I know he had eaten some crumbs from a chocolate cake earlier (left the bowl on the couch) but it wasnt much at all so i hope that isnt why he is feeling like this |
